Handle with care – guidelines for effective web content management.
Robust web content management tools are a great way for you to take control of your company’s website, but there are limits and guidelines that should be followed to maintain the integrity of the design.
The ability to update your website is a feature that most of our clients want, and our content management system can allow you to update images, add pages, delete pages, and change web copy in a moments notice. While experience in html, xhtml, css, javascript, and other programming languages isn’t necessary, it is important that the updates are handled by one or two people who have been properly trained. The primary concern would be accidental page deletion, though regular website backups will allow you to retrieve the deleted page if that should ever happen. Some questions that will need to be answered include: What happens to the navigation when a page is added? What if I add a picture that’s the wrong size? Can I change the font from black to lemon yellow?
We will work with you up-front to determine your training needs and can put together a training package with guidelines that will help you to maintain your website without straying from the final design. Text style sheets created by our designers and developers will provide you with a preset range of font families, colors and sizes to choose from that are consistent from page to page. Is lemon yellow a good idea for a font color? Probably not, so sticking to the predetermined choices is key to maintaining readability and consistency throughout your site.
We can also provide your team with layered Photoshop files, so that you can replicate photo design effects with new images, but this requires compatible software. If new images are added without any style effects, they will look out of place, and it is important to either budget for the software or to have the photos styled by our agency, as needed.
In summary, content management can be very basic to somewhat involved – gaining maximum control of your website requires training for at least one or two key people, robust image editing software and strict adherence to our guidelines to make your updates appear like they are part of one harmonious plan.
